Object-oriented analysis and its advantages.
Approach of analyzing system using objects is known as object-oriented analysis.
Explanation of Solution
Object-oriented analysis is based on objects and their interaction with the system. Objects can be any identifying entity such as a person, machine, place or any transaction which interacts as a group.
When one buys a product from market then customer, product, shopkeeper, the company all interact with each other and thus they are distinctive objects. Object−oriented analysis is an approach to analyze the system through its group of objects and their functions to create an object model. Object model is a system based on object and its interactions in the form of functions.
Advantages of object-oriented analysis:
- Focus is on object or data and not on procedures or functions.
- Effective in utilizing concepts of data encapsulation and data hiding.
- It develops modules which can be easily reused and can be upgraded from smaller modules to large modules.
